The No. 2 Arizona Wildcats (7-0) host the No. 20 Auburn Tigers (7-2) after winning four straight home games. The Wildcats are favored by 9.5 points in the contest, which begins at 10 p.m. ET on Saturday, December 6, 2025. The over/under in the matchup is set at 161.5.

Arizona statistics, trends and more
As the home team
- Against the spread last season, Arizona played better when playing at home, covering nine times in 16 home games, and six times in 11 road games.
- In terms of over/unders, the Wildcats hit the over more consistently at home last season, as they went over the total nine times in 16 opportunities (56.2%). In away games, they hit the over five times in 11 opportunities (45.5%).
- In home games last season, Arizona won more often as a moneyline favorite, posting a record of 13-2 (.867). When playing on the road, it was 3-2 (.600) as a moneyline favorite.
Last season stats
- The Wildcats were the 16th-best team in the nation in points scored (82.5 per game) and 219th in points allowed (73.3) last year.
- Last season, Arizona was 14th-best in the nation in rebounds (36.4 per game) and 38th in rebounds conceded (28.6).
- With 16.2 assists per game last season, the Wildcats were 32nd in college basketball.

Auburn statistics, trends and more
As the away team
- Auburn’s winning percentage against the spread at home last season was .533 (8-7-0). Away, it was .500 (5-5-0).
- Tigers games went above the over/under 60% of the time at home (nine of 15) last season, and 70% of the time away (seven of 10).
Last season stats
- The Tigers gave up 69.4 points per game last season (87th-ranked in college basketball), but they really thrived on offense, putting up 83.0 points per game (13th-best).
- With 34.4 boards per game, Auburn ranked 53rd in college basketball. It allowed 29.7 rebounds per contest, which ranked 82nd in college basketball.
- The Tigers delivered 16.1 assists per game, which ranked them 34th in the country.
